Sites como Ohloh e Github apenas fornecem uma indicação do que está acontecendo no mundo do código aberto e não levam em consideração o lado comercial (muito maior) comercial / industrial / de código fechado; O Google Trends fornece todos os tipos de hits para "subversão" e "git" (ambos com outros significados fora do mundo do SCM).
O melhor indicador que você provavelmente encontrará no momento é a Pesquisa da Comunidade Eclipse. Isso é realizado todos os anos pela Eclipse Foundation e, como os usuários do Eclipse tendem a ser desenvolvedores Java de todas as formas e tamanhos, ele tem como alvo uma seção bastante representativa da comunidade de desenvolvimento de software como um todo. O único problema é que os desenvolvedores do Windows provavelmente estão sub-representados, mas, no entanto, ele ainda fornece um guia razoável de como as coisas estão e, como já está acontecendo há alguns anos, você pode começar a ver quais tendências estão começando. emergir.
Seus números para o Git são:
- 2009: 2,4%
- 2010: 6,8%
- 2011: 12,8%
- 2012: 27,6%
- 2013: 30,3%
- 2014: 33,3%
Para Subversion:
- 2009: 57,5%
- 2010: 58,3%
- 2011: 51,3%
- 2012: 46,0%
- 2013: 37,8%
- 2014: 30,7%
O relatório da pesquisa de 2012 será lançado nas próximas semanas. Enquanto isso, outro ponto de dados que podemos considerar é o crescimento do Github. Em agosto, observei que tinha pouco menos de um milhão de usuários, embora não tenha registrado o número exato. Isso aumentou para 1.654.419 usuários no momento da redação: um aumento de pelo menos 66% em 288 dias, ou cerca de 90% ao ano. Se assumirmos que o crescimento do Github é indicativo da taxa de aumento do uso do Git em todo o setor (uma suposição potencialmente duvidosa: veja os comentários abaixo), isso sugere que a adoção do Git está atualmente entre 20% e 25% em todo o setor e a caminho de ultrapassar o Subversion no slot número 1 em algum momento nos próximos 12 a 18 meses.
Atualização: os resultados da Pesquisa da comunidade Eclipse 2012 dão ao Git / Github uma participação de mercado total de 27,6%. Isso é muito mais do que eu esperava (pensei que seria 20s na melhor das hipóteses) e significa que agora quase certamente tem uma penetração significativa nos ambientes corporativos e empresariais. O Subversion ainda está no slot número 1 por enquanto, mas, considerando esses números, eu ficaria muito surpreso se esse ainda for o caso desta vez no próximo ano.
Atualização: os resultados foram adicionados à Pesquisa da Comunidade Eclipse 2013. Agora, o Git está quase com o mesmo uso que o subversion (36,3% vs 37,8%, respectivamente) e, se a tendência continuar, estará facilmente em primeiro lugar nos resultados da pesquisa do próximo ano.
Atualização: Os resultados da Pesquisa da Comunidade Eclipse de 2014 mostram que o Git (33,3%) supera o Subversion (30,7%), conforme esperado da tendência do ano anterior.
Fontes: